Q: Is 343,441 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 343,441 is not a prime number.

Why is 343,441 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 343441 can be evenly divided by 1 7 43 49 163 301 1,141 2,107 7,009 7,987 49,063 and 343,441, with no remainder.

Since 343,441 cannot be divided by just 1 and 343,441, it is not a prime number.
